C# SuperSocket學習筆記一,下載代碼編譯

一、自我介紹

      我是一名C#初學者,本來是做JavaEE和Android的最近閒的沒事做想學學其他語言,網上看了下最火的是python,python看了幾天感覺不是我想要學的,於是就看了下C#,學着學着就看到SuperSocket了,對這個框架很剛興趣所以一直在看從搭建環境到今天的運行Hello程序折騰了好幾天,不是說人家的框架不好是我的基礎能力太差了對C#和VS工具不熟悉導致的,既然運行通過了我想把這個過程記錄下讓更多的人少走彎路。

二、SuperSocket官方介紹

       SuperSocket官網:http://www.supersocket.net/

       SuperSocket框架文檔:http://docs.supersocket.net/

       SuperSocket 源碼路徑:https://github.com/kerryjiang/SuperSocket.git

      github網址:https://github.com/kerryjiang/SuperSocket

   

三、環境介紹

     1、使用的VS2019及VS運行環境

      2、會使用git工具下載代碼

四、SuperSocket代碼下載方法

      1、首先打開github網址複製SuperSocket的源碼路徑,然後在git工具上執行如下命令 

 git clone -b v1.6 https://github.com/kerryjiang/SuperSocket.git

SuperSocket目前作者正在開發2.0版本,我學習的是1.6版本其實都是一樣的,所以我們要下載v1.6的分支,這個很重要哦,不要下載錯代碼了分支不一樣代碼肯定也是不一樣的,下載下來後打開目錄裏面有個BuildQuickStart.bat的批處理只要你的VS環境正常的話執行批處理後會編譯生成可執行文件和dll的

 

如果上面腳本執行成功,接下來你就可以看官網的文檔執行Hello程序了,裏面也有Demo很好用你根據官網的文檔去執行就沒問題了。

 第一個程序就是TelnetServer,如果你不瞭解TelnetServer的話請查看 https://www.cnblogs.com/ylcms/p/7250129.html這個網址然後第一個程序就能運行通過。

 

總結:我運行一個Hello程序折騰了好幾天是我剛開始下載的是2.0的代碼,2.0代碼官方文檔還沒出來沒能折騰出來然後去找V1.6代碼,我剛開始沒找到V1.6代碼分支從第三方網站上下載的,光下載就耗時間很長然後編譯沒通過又花費了時間,對VS不熟悉花了一點時間總之程序員要有耐性,遇到問題要一個一個去克服。

 

 

     


 
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章